In a league where passing as often as you can is the way to win, defense remains a priority for any team. The Bears have been solid defensively so far this season, thanks in no small part to the play of cornerback Tim Jennings, which has come as a surprise to many fans and media.

The Chicago Sun Times reports that for Jennings, it’s pretty much business as usual.  He has been doubted before and is used to proving all of us wrong.

It’s actually a story you hear a lot. Smaller players (Jennings is 5’8″) are often overlooked, especially as receivers and, as in Jennings’ case, defensive backs. 

However, many overcome that with hard work and determination. Jennings has a knack for making big plays, and it’s undoubtedly because he makes up for his lack of size with film work and instinct.

The Bears have been depending on him a lot and he has stepped up to the challenge.

It’s hard to say if he can keep it up, but I wouldn’t be against him.
